Background
A bolt is a mechanical part, and a cylindrical threaded fastener matched with a nut is a fastener consisting of a head part and a screw (a cylinder with an external thread) and needs to be matched with the nut to be used for fastening and connecting two parts with through holes.
For the existing bolt processing jig, the bolts are small and are often difficult to clamp accurately, so that the bolt processing speed is slow, the processing efficiency is low, meanwhile, in the process of processing different bolts, the positions of clamping are required to be changed continuously for processing, manual continuous operation is required, and waste time and labor are wasted.

In the figure: the device comprises a shell 1, a fixing plate 2, a lead screw 3, a moving motor 4, a sliding seat 5, a bearing seat 6, an electric telescopic rod 7, a toothed groove 8, a rotating motor 9, a gear 10, an opening 11, a placing plate 12, a clamping mechanism 13, a fixing plate 131, a threaded rod 132, a clamping motor 133, a screw cylinder 134, a clamping plate 135, a clamping groove 136, a limiting rod 137, a positioning rod 14 and a universal wheel 15.

Referring to fig. 1-2, a bolt processing jig with high fixing efficiency comprises a housing 1, two fixing plates 2 symmetrically arranged are fixedly connected to the lower end of the inner wall of the housing 1, a lead screw 3 is rotatably connected between the two fixing plates 2 through a ball bearing, a moving motor 4 is fixedly connected to one end of the lead screw 3 through the side wall of the fixing plate 2, a slide carriage 5 is slidably sleeved on the rod wall of the lead screw 3, a bearing seat 6 is fixedly connected to the upper end of the slide carriage 5, an electric telescopic rod 7 is rotatably connected to the upper end of the bearing seat 6 through a ball bearing, a tooth socket 8 is formed in the side wall of the electric telescopic rod 7, a rotating motor 9 is fixedly connected to the upper end of the slide carriage 5, a gear 10 meshed with the tooth socket 8 is fixedly connected to the output shaft of the rotating motor 9, an opening 11, the upper end of the shell 1 is fixedly connected with a clamping mechanism 13.
Fixture 13 includes the fixed block 131 that fixed connection set up at two symmetries of casing 1 upper end, it is connected with threaded rod 132 to rotate through ball bearing between two fixed blocks 131, the lateral wall fixedly connected with centre gripping motor 133 of fixed block 131 is run through to the one end of threaded rod 132, the pole wall both ends external screw thread of threaded rod 132 is opposite, screw section of thick bamboo 134 has all been cup jointed in the equal slip on the both ends pole wall of threaded rod 132, the equal fixedly connected with grip block 135 of lateral wall of two screw sections 134, the centre gripping groove 136 has all been seted up to the one side in opposite directions of two grip.
A limiting rod 137 penetrating through the side walls of the two screw cylinders 134 is fixedly connected between the two fixing blocks 131.
A positioning rod 14 penetrating through the side wall of the sliding seat 5 is fixedly connected between the two fixing plates 2.
The four corners of the lower end of the shell 1 are fixedly connected with universal wheels 15.
The utility model discloses in, during the use, place the bolt on placing board 12 earlier, it drives lead screw 3 and rotates to open moving motor 4, make slide 5 slide to suitable position, open simultaneously and rotate motor 9 and drive electric telescopic handle 7 through the meshing of gear 10 and tooth's socket 8 and rotate, open electric telescopic handle 7 simultaneously and make and place board 12 and remove suitable position, then open centre gripping motor 133 and drive threaded rod 132 and rotate, and then make two grip blocks 135 relative motions with the bolt clamp tight, whole equipment structure is simple, can process each angle of bolt, the machining efficiency of bolt is improved, the use of people is made things convenient for, people's work has been reduced, can adapt to the bolt of different specifications, the application range of equipment is improved, people's demand has been satisfied.
